Referee Hand Alerts: Preserving the sport Truthful
Referees use an internationally standardized list of hand indicators to communicate their rulings to players, coaches, and spectators. These alerts are apparent, concise, and designed to minimize confusion.

Some key referee hand alerts involve:

Issue Sign: The referee extends just one arm toward the group that earned The purpose following a rally.

Ball In: An open hand details straight to the floor, signaling that the ball landed In the courtroom boundaries.

Ball Out: The two arms are raised vertically to point the ball landed exterior the court strains.

Double Contact: The referee raises two fingers, demonstrating that a player strike the ball two times in succession.

Web Violation: Touching the highest of the net which has a hand suggests a player built illegal connection with The web.

Lift or Have: An upward motion by having an open palm reveals the ball was not cleanly strike and was alternatively lifted or carried.

Rotation Fault: The referee tends to make a round motion with their finger, signaling that gamers are outside of rotational buy.

These alerts support implement The principles consistently and permit everyone to Keep to the game’s selections without needing a proof when.

Player Hand Indicators: Strategy in Silence
Players—Primarily blockers—use hand signals to communicate defensive tactic. These signals are sometimes built powering the back again prior to the serve to maintain the opposing team from viewing the Trang Chá»§ RR88 system.

Here are some frequent player hand indicators:

A person Finger: Alerts that the blocker will try to cease the hitter's line shot.

Two Fingers: Suggests a block centered on defending the cross-court docket angle.

Shut Fist: Implies no block, normally utilized when planning to drop back into defense.

Open Hand: Occasionally used to direct the server to target a specific region or player.

Thumb Pointed Back: Indicates the blocker will phony then drop to the back again row for coverage.

These signals help gamers continue to be coordinated without the need of Talking, which is very significant in competitive and noisy settings.
